The corrugated box printing business occupies the largest part of the packaging printing ink market. It is a $23 billion industry that accounts for 1/3 of the total ink used in the packaging market. About 75% of them are flexo inks and are mainly aqueous products.
Perhaps the biggest change in the next few years will be in the corrugated box printing sector. The nature of the industry has changed due to the migration of production bases overseas and the development of digital technologies.
In recent years, unemployment in the United States and Mexico has been shocking due to the migration of manufacturing jobs to China and other overseas countries. As a result, those who relocate and consider shipping costs naturally chose the packaging part near the production site, which has had an impact on ink production in the United States. In addition, the price of cartons shipped from China is very low, which allows manufacturers in the United States to maintain a larger inventory, thereby reducing overall transportation costs.

The problem encountered in the corrugated box market in the United States does not seem to disappear in the near future. Impastato thinks it is like other printing markets and has been affected by the recession of the past few years. However, when other markets may recover completely when the economy improves, the corrugated box market may still suffer. As the manufacturing industry migrates overseas, the production of transport packaging corrugated boxes is also being relocated. However, he pointed out that corrugated carton packaging is making impressive progress in the production of fresh products. For several years, corrugated boxes have been replaced by reusable plastic containers (RPC). This trend now begins to have a certain degree of reversal: In the next few years, RPC will occupy a smaller share of the production transport container market, while corrugated cartons will gain more shares.
Pioneers in the industry pointed out that inkjet technology will one day affect the corrugated box market.
Young believes that digital technology will occupy a place and will have a revolutionary impact on short-run printing. There is no doubt that they will increase the speed of printing. Callif pointed out that "digital technology is slowly advancing, but it is indeed progressing. More and more companies are involved in this area, and if they succeed, ink-jet technology will be noticeable growth, because digital technology is very short-term printing. It's profitable. Ultraviolet digital inks may have the greatest impact because they have the advantage of eliminating the need to pre-treat substrate substrates compared to waterborne products.” (To be continued)
